House Plans That Save You Money

0
Mel Inglima asked:




House plans dictate costs to build. Or, at the very least they certainly can have a huge impact on the costs. Blueprints (house plans) detail many things. The biggest job of your house blueprints is to provide detailed instructions on what and how things are to be done.

What is Your Home Building Goal?

Before you begin any home building project, and before you purchase any home plans, you need to be clear about what you’re after. Does your proposed house size fit your needs? How many rooms, bedrooms, and square feet do you want? What kind of quality is important to you? What about energy efficiency and cost to build?

Naturally, you’re going to want to get what you want and it starts with a good floor plan, house plan, and blueprints.

Prepare Home Plans Properly

There are certainly many ways to save money when building a home. Probably the most important ways are hidden right in the home’s design.

There is much more to home building plans than meets the casual eye. There’s an entire story in a set of blueprints. Yet, there’s a word of caution here. Cheaply prepared, poorly thought out house plans may not provide you with what you need or want. Deficient plans do not help you achieve your goals as well as properly prepared plans.

How Do House Plans Save You Money?

Let’s get right to the nub. Here are the most critical components of your home’s design and the detailed information that a good set of house plans should contain.

DESIGN PHASE

Your home’s overall design plays a huge roll in the eventual cost to build the home. Uncomplicated foundations and rooflines are just two examples of this. The size of your home is another significant factor. The bigger the home, the more it will cost. Types of construction methods and materials are additional important factors. The more unique the materials that are called for, the more expensive the construction will be. Energy efficiency and lifetime value cannot be ignored if your goal is to save money. Both of these are longer-term benefits, but the savings begin building right away.

PREPARATION OF BLUEPRINTS

Details of construction methods in the blueprints should leave no doubt or guessing as to how something is to be built. Detailed materials lists (or “take-offs” from the house plans) will allow you to shop around for the best deals. Detailed home plans and blueprints make the subcontractors’ jobs easier and often result in lower, more accurate bids. Extra sets of your house-plans make it easier for you to get plenty of competitive bids quickly.

Saving money on your construction project starts at the very beginning. Paying a little more for good design and detailed blueprints will pay off in the long run.

What Are Architectural House Plans? Basic Factors & Considerations

0
Richard M Bothom asked:




Architectural House plans are general documents that include specifications a builder may require to guide the contractor in building construction. A house plan is generally developed by an architect or draftsmen and contains floor plans; framing and foundation details, electrical and plumbing layout and specific details for construction process.

For building contractors house plans work as a guide to assist them before, during and after construction of the building or home. Most such plans contains 2D (two-dimensional) drawings and specific instructions to describe in detail how to build the house. They also contain detailed instructions on the type of materials required to build the home. Once the plans are concluded, they are handed over to the contractor to find out cost-estimation. The standard size of such plans is 18 inches x 24 inches or 24 inches x 36 inches.

In order to generate realistic plans, the architect will need to know the dimensions of the house and measurement of landscape. This will help in deciding the type and quantity of materials that will be required. Architectural House plans are general documents that include specifications a builder may require to guide the contractor in building construction. This plan is generally developed by an architect or draftsmen and contains floor plans; framing and foundation details, electrical and plumbing layout and specific details for construction process.

With these details one can take informed decision on where certain rooms will be located such as drawing room, master bedroom and kitchen.

Size of the plan is dependent on the on the number of people expected to live in the home. If extra rooms are desired, such as a guest room, the size will be much bigger. Before developing any plans, a builder must discuss with the neighbor homeowners association to check if there are any kind of restrictions on the shape, size and place where the building will be constructed. You may face some encounter restrictions regarding the size of the house or its location within the lot. When crafting such plans, every detail of the house must be incorporated. If details are skipped or local building codes are not considered, the contractor may be denied the required approvals and permissions.

New House Floor Plans & Questions to Consider

0
Ian M MacDonald asked:




If you are building a new house it is crucial that you have a thorough understanding of the build and design process such as your house floor plans, site / foundation layout and how your house will look once constructed. The following points outline some important questions to consider when it comes to your new house floor plans.

What Style of Home Do You Want?

Depending on your lifestyle at present and where you hope to be in the future, will help you determine the style of home you need. If you are a young couple building your first house together and you hope to start a family then it is important that you factor in such features as outdoor living areas, space and rooms for the children. A great place to gain ideas and inspiration about house plans is to talk to family, friends and work colleagues who have been through the home building process. Ask them about the pro’s and con’s, what worked well for them and what they wish they had done differently. Once you have gathered an idea of what you like put it down in writing and pictures, then present these to your architect or builder who will formulate a working drawing of your proposed new home.

How Much Will It Cost and What Can You Afford?

Your first step here should be to devise a budget. Make an appointment with your banks mortgage manager or home loan specialist so that you can get a financial understanding of what you can afford to spend and pay back. This is a key step which enables you to either cut back on building costs / plans or alternatively allow for additional features you weren’t sure you could afford. If you are getting an architectural design company to design your blueprints make sure you find out what their working drawing will include price wise by obtaining a quote. For example some companies may or may not include landscaping details, retaining wall details, building permits and council fees in the final quote. Having a cost estimate for your new house will help you anticipate hidden costs which are more than likely to pop up along the way.

Should You Employ a House Building Company or Builder?

There are several options available to you when it comes to implementing your blueprints into action. Design and Build companies generally manage the whole process from your new home plans, consents & permits, gathering building materials through to site construction. You’re able to judge the quality and style of designs available by viewing the company’s show homes. An advantage to going through a design and build company is that you can see what you will get before you invest. Another option is to employ the services of an independent builder. If you decide upon the latter option be sure to ask to see examples of their work, get time frame estimates of when you can be in your new home and draw up a building contract that fully comprises all of your expectations.

It is a very exciting time building a home from scratch, but it can quickly become overwhelming given the array of details that encompass floor plans and site construction. Be sure to consider each of the above questions and research each possibility before making a solid commitment.

Durable Wooden House

0
Justine Noerrahmi asked:




Wooden house construction is no longer built in traditional taste but harmonious with the era change. Nowadays, another type of wooden house can be found as a feature of comfortable living.

A Wood house provides more warmth and elegance in homes than man-made substitutes such as, steel or brick. It is an alternative that people made to live greener and environmentally safe. Besides, it is a wonderful thing living in wood home which is closest to the nature atmosphere.

There is no hesitation that wood is a durable material for making such things from furniture, crafts or even house. Wood house made of solid wood stands for versatility, strength and high quality. Hence, wood is resistant to weather problem like, heat, frost, corrosion and pollution. But the only factor that needs to control is moisture.

With good design and construction, wood need little maintenance or barely chemical treatment for longevity. Kiln-dried timber construction is used by wooden house manufacturer to ensure the sustainability and durability. Easily to work with, wood is also a good insulator and has greater structural flexibility, allowing it to absorb the ground tremors. House made of wood material can be constructed in all weather countries by adapting the culture and condition.

By its flexibility, the house model is also known as its durability when experiencing natural disaster called earthquake. The knock-down system with no nails attached but only pegged joints allow the house to withstand the natural disaster. It is another advantage of having wooden house as home living.

House Floor Plans

0
Kristy Annely asked:




House floor plans essentially fall into two categories – custom-drawn and pre-drawn floor plans. It can take a lot of time, money and effort if one chooses the former. Moreover, a pre-drawn floor plan, apart from saving money and time, also lends itself to modifications as per one’s needs.

One can safely assume that many pre-drawn house floor plans have already been tried and tested. That means construction hassles would have already been sorted out, which implies that any additional labor costs and uncertainties during the construction phase will not exist.

Final cost estimates of the pre-drawn house floor plans are more likely to be precise because the particulars have been figured out. This means a list of materials has already been made out, for example. The chances of suddenly discovering that the building is beyond the budget after all are fairly small. Sensible buyers would happily save on architect’s fees for designing floor plans.

House floor plans that are already in stock are as good as their custom-made counterparts, as they, too, were once custom-made by capable engineers and architects. Moreover, the construction papers will come to hand in a matter of days rather than months.

Look at it this way – the largest assortment of quality house floor plans in one place will ensure that the perfect design for particular tastes will be found. There are different kinds of house plan drawings that one needs to look into before building a home.

A ‘construction set’ is a collection of drawings one needs in order to acquire a building authorization, put the financing aspects in place and build a home. This collection comprises five complete sets of house floor plans. Each set has a view of the external walls from all four sides, a comprehensive set of floor plans, a basement plan, a roof plan and other pertinent details.

A ‘reproducible set’ makes it easier to implement minor changes because this set of house plans is typically on vellum paper or erasable Mylar. This set of house floor plans includes a building license that can only be used once.

A ‘CAD set’ helps one make extensive changes to the plan with the help of a design expert. It is comparable to the reproducible set, except it is in an electronic format.

A ‘study set’ helps one ascertain if his home can be built within budget. The floor plans in this set include a view of the outside from all four sides, plus the main story and any additional stories.

‘Single set’ is for finding contractor bids, and this set of house floor plans does not incorporate a building license.
